What to Expect from the Rome Bike Rental Experience

Rome: Bike Rental 4-hours - What to Expect from the Rome Bike Rental Experience

This 4-hour bike rental provides a straightforward way to see Rome without the fuss of guided buses or lengthy group tours. You’ll start at the Touristation Aracoeli, located beneath the iconic Piazza Ara Coeli. The meeting point is easy to find, marked by orange flags outside the office, although one review highlighted an unfriendly staff member during bike collection. This suggests that while the process may be smooth for some, others might encounter less welcoming service—something to keep in mind if you’re expecting a warm welcome.

Once you’re on your bike, the real fun begins. The bikes are described as comfortable and easy to ride, making them suitable whether you’re a seasoned cyclist or a casual rider. You’ll have four hours to pedal through Rome’s streets, which gives ample time to visit major monuments at your own pace.

Additional Options and Upgrades

If you’re worried about hills or long distances, you can upgrade to an electric bike at the Touristation Office, making the ride easier and more comfortable. Child seats are also available for the little ones, so the whole family can join in. The total duration is four hours, with the last rental starting at 3:00 PM—perfect for those wanting a leisurely afternoon adventure.

Practicalities and Logistics

The meeting point is straightforward, and the process of exchanging your voucher is simple. While the activity is suitable for most, it’s important to note that it’s not suitable for people with mobility impairments or wheelchair users. Also, you’ll want to bring your passport or ID card and wear comfortable shoes for the ride.

The activity is flexible with free cancellation up to 24 hours beforehand, providing some peace of mind if your plans shift unexpectedly. Payments can be made later, giving you the chance to reserve without immediate commitment.
